Orthographic Transcriptions
Description
Typed transcriptions (by Stanley Ellis) of informants from Survey of English Dialects (SED) audio-recordings, made in Horsington (1956) and South Zeal (1963); and a typed paper by Martyn Wakelin, 'The Implication of Cornish Loan-Words'.
